Simple Steps to Make Soft Pretzel Bites

Making soft pretzel bites is surprisingly easy. With just a few ingredients and some simple steps, you can have these delicious treats ready for any occasion. You may also find Soft Pretzel Bites useful.

Ingredients

  • 4 ½ c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tablespoon sugar
  • 2 ¼ teaspoons instant yeast
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 ¾ cups warm milk (or water)
  • 2 tablespoons melted butter
  • 9 cups water
  • 1/2 cup baking soda
  • 1 large egg (mixed with 1 tablespoon of water)

Directions

In a stand mixer bowl, combine the flour, sugar, yeast, milk, butter, and salt. Mix with a dough hook on medium speed for about 4-5 minutes until a smooth dough forms. If the dough is too sticky, add a little more flour. Cover the bowl and let the dough rise in a warm place for 30-60 minutes until doubled in size. Preheat your oven to 450°F. Line two baking sheets with parchment paper.

Bring the water and baking soda to a boil in a large pot. Divide the dough into 12 pieces. Roll each into a ¾-inch rope and cut into 1-2 inch bites. Drop the bites into boiling water for 30 seconds, then transfer to the prepared baking sheets. Leave a little space between each one. Brush with egg wash and sprinkle with salt. Bake for 12-14 minutes until golden brown. Serve with honey mustard!

Storing Soft Pretzel Bites

If you have any leftovers, place them in an airtight container and store them in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. To reheat, just pop them in the oven at 350°F for about 5-10 minutes to restore their softness.

Pro Tips for Perfect Pretzel Bites

  • Make sure your water is just warm, not too hot, to activate the yeast properly.
  • Don’t skip the baking soda bath; this step is crucial for achieving that classic pretzel flavor and texture.
  • Experiment with toppings—try adding sesame seeds or everything bagel seasoning instead of salt for a unique twist.

Frequently Asked Questions

Soft Pretzel Bites

1. Can I freeze soft pretzel bites?
Yes, you can freeze them! Just make sure they are cooled completely, then store them in a freezer-safe container for up to a month.

2. Can I use whole wheat flour?
Absolutely! Whole wheat flour will give them a slightly different texture but can still be delicious.

3. How do I know when the dough has risen enough?
The dough should roughly double in size. If it’s nicely puffed up, you’re ready to go!
